    Rox high-grade gold outside Youanmi plan: design and scheduling notes for mine planners

    First reported on Australian Mining

    30 Second Briefing

    Rox Resources has reported new high-grade gold intercepts outside the current definitive feasibility study mine plan at the Youanmi gold project in Western Australia, signalling potential to extend the planned underground and open-pit mining inventory. The discovery sits beyond the existing resource envelope defined in the DFS, which already targets redevelopment of historic workings and existing processing infrastructure on site. For geotechnical and mine planners, the step-out mineralisation may require updated pit shells, revised stope designs and additional drilling to constrain geometry, continuity and ground conditions.

    Technical Brief

    • Mineralisation style remains consistent with existing shear-hosted lodes, simplifying geotechnical and structural interpretation.
    • Additional drilling data will feed into updated resource wireframes and revised geotechnical domains for stope optimisation.

    Our Take

    Rox Resources’ recent final investment decision and $350 million funding package for the Youanmi gold project mean any high‑grade ounces discovered outside the current mine plan can now be evaluated as potential early-life feed or mine-life extensions rather than speculative upside.

    With MACA Interquip Mintrex already lined up as preferred EPC contractor for the Youanmi processing plant, incremental high‑grade gold discoveries in Western Australia can be folded into plant design and scheduling relatively quickly, influencing throughput and cut‑off strategies before detailed engineering is locked in.

    Integra’s 74% reserve lift at Florida Canyon: project economics for mine planners

    Integra Resources’ updated feasibility study for the Florida Canyon heap leach mine in Nevada lifts proven and probable reserves 74% to 1.1 million oz at 0.31 g/t, raises planned output to 82,000 oz gold per year over eight years, and boosts the 5% NPV to US$601 million using a US$4,200/oz price. All-in sustaining costs climb 43% to US$2,331/oz with recovery steady at 62%, but post-tax free cash flow is projected at US$800 million, averaging US$90 million annually. Integra is drilling 42,500 metres around the existing operation to grow resources and fund its DeLamar gold-silver project in Idaho.

    DRC critical minerals strategy: price-setting and supply risks for mine planners

    Democratic Republic of Congo has shifted from price-taker to price-setter in cobalt by imposing ARECOMS-managed export quotas and planning state stockpiles of cobalt, coltan and germanium. Cobalt prices have climbed from about $21,000/t in early 2025 to just over $56,000/t, with Kinshasa forecasting $2.3 billion in fiscal revenues this year versus an estimated $617 million without intervention. Advisory input from Vectus Global and new investment moves such as Virtus Minerals’ acquisition of Chemaf signal tighter supply discipline and a push for higher value-added partnerships.

    Ground view Kazakhstan: digitised Soviet data and reserve codes for explorers

    Kazakhstan is racing to digitise a vast Soviet-era geological archive, with 1960s seismic data still stored on magnetic tape that can only be read on perhaps three surviving machines using playback needles no longer manufactured since the Brezhnev era. The National Geological Service aims to convert millions of pages of hand-drawn, non-standardised maps into polygons, vectors and points for AI-driven targeting of critical minerals, while also restating Soviet GKZ-classified reserves into KAZRC, JORC or NI 43‑101, with only about 143 of 400–500 major deposits converted so far. More than US$17 billion in recent US–Kazakh trade and investment deals, plus a new memorandum with Saudi Arabia, signal that access to this “pre-paid exploration” data is becoming a key competitive factor for mid-tier and junior explorers.
